Drug discovery company Bugworks has raised $9 million in a Series A round of funding led by University of Tokyo Edge Capital (UTEC) while online mattress company Wakefit is in advanced talks with three venture capital funds including Sequoia to raise about Rs 40 crore. Also, Sminq is in talks with private equity firms to raise $8-10 million. In another development, Amazon India has signed an MoU with the Uttar Pradesh government to support MSME entrepreneurs.
